A computer beam saw is an industrial panel-cutting machine designed for computer-controlled processing of large sheet materials. It can cut large-sized whole sheets into your required small-sized components, widely applied in the custom furniture, cabinet manufacturing, and wood processing industries.

ElephMax Computer Beam Saw Features

Main & Scoring Blades
Main & Scoring Blades

The main saw and scoring saw work together to reduce chipping and improve edge quality when cutting laminated panels.

Stack Cutting
Stack Cutting

Supports stack cutting of multiple panels, with up to 80–120 mm total book height depending on your machine configuration and material.

Servo-Driven Carriage
Servo-Driven Carriage

Driven by high-precision servo motors and precise gear-rack mechanisms. The positioning accuracy can be controlled within ±0.1 mm.

Automatic Rear Loading
Automatic Rear Loading

Can be equipped with a rear feeding hydraulic lifting platform. The entire panel material can be automatically pushed into the machine from the rear.

High Operator Safety

A traditional push-type saw requires workers to manually push the panel past the high-speed rotating saw blade. However, ElephMax computer beam saws help maintain separation between the operator and the cutting zone. Your operator only needs to handle the materials externally. 

Our machines are equipped with photoelectric safety curtains, emergency stop switches, and protective barriers. Human hands do not need to contact the saw blade. Therefore, the safety level is significantly improved.

Stress-relieved Frame

Stress-relieved Frame

To ensure our computer beam saws do not deform under high-load operation, ElephMax has their steel structures undergo natural aging treatment and overall heat treatment after welding. Therefore, the residual stress in the steel is reduced. This can ensure that ElephMax computer beam saws can maintain their original physical accuracy under long-term continuous use.

Non-Wood Panel Materials
Non-Wood Panel Materials

By adjusting the saw blade rotation speed and feed speed of the saw table, ElephMax computer beam saws can be adapted to the different physical properties of plastics and composite materials. You can use ElephMax computer beam saws for processing non-wood materials, such as acrylic panels, PVC/ABS plastic panels, PS/PC building panels, and insulating bakelite panels.

What is a Beam Saw Used for?

The beam saw is used to cut large panels of material into various standardized small-sized square components. Usually, it is applied in furniture manufacturing and high-volume stacked cutting. Except for cutting wood, it can also handle acrylic, PVC/plastic panels, insulation panels, etc.

Can a Computer Beam Saw Handle Different Panel Sizes?

Yes. Standard computer beam saws have a maximum cutting length ranging from 3200 mm to 4300 mm. The minimum processing size can be as small as 34 mm × 45 mm.
